Output 2645b8c9e6638179d72be2ed5d692456e37e1d856ddcd48df24e9b23f05e6bc4:5

value
691060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66952ac8789e8d2384caf525a18314af6960ed16 OP_EQUAL
address
3B3RYRXm2bzgQNTMJK4NugCUaUKr6HQB79
transaction
2645b8c9e6638179d72be2ed5d692456e37e1d856ddcd48df24e9b23f05e6bc4
spent
true